Gaussian distribution (if for an unshifted/unflipped value, use min, max, and/or flip). More...
#include <probability_distribution.h>

Public Member Functions | |
| virtual double | evaluate (double value) const |
| GaussianProbabilityDistribution (double mean, double std_dev, double min, double max, bool flip) | |
Protected Attributes | |
| bool | flip_ |
| double | max_ |
| double | mean_ |
| double | min_ |
| double | std_dev_ |
Gaussian distribution (if for an unshifted/unflipped value, use min, max, and/or flip).
Definition at line 54 of file probability_distribution.h.
| bayesian_grasp_planner::GaussianProbabilityDistribution::GaussianProbabilityDistribution | ( | double | mean, | |
| double | std_dev, | |||
| double | min, | |||
| double | max, | |||
| bool | flip | |||
| ) | [inline] |
Definition at line 63 of file probability_distribution.h.
| virtual double bayesian_grasp_planner::GaussianProbabilityDistribution::evaluate | ( | double | value | ) | const [inline, virtual] |
Implements bayesian_grasp_planner::ProbabilityDistribution.
Definition at line 66 of file probability_distribution.h.
bool bayesian_grasp_planner::GaussianProbabilityDistribution::flip_ [protected] |
Definition at line 61 of file probability_distribution.h.
double bayesian_grasp_planner::GaussianProbabilityDistribution::max_ [protected] |
Definition at line 60 of file probability_distribution.h.
double bayesian_grasp_planner::GaussianProbabilityDistribution::mean_ [protected] |
Definition at line 57 of file probability_distribution.h.
double bayesian_grasp_planner::GaussianProbabilityDistribution::min_ [protected] |
Definition at line 59 of file probability_distribution.h.
double bayesian_grasp_planner::GaussianProbabilityDistribution::std_dev_ [protected] |
Definition at line 58 of file probability_distribution.h.